Well this has been happening on my Getz these days too. There seems to be a flat spot past 3K revs. Dustom can you please elaborate on how to test the turbo vgt valve - is this the solenoid valve which opens the variable vanes to control the boost pressure automatically?

The car does exactly 170kmph at 3500 revs and it does not pass it. It hits a road block there. It used to cross 170 with ease before. Things which i think would be the problem:
1. Water in fuel tank
2. VGT boost solenoid valve malfunctioning
3. Vacuum hoses of the turbo boost mechanism has leak
4. Fuel pump malfunctioning

Have i missed anything? Please give some pointers

hmm , ill tell what all ive tried and yet the problem is not sorted .
  1. All pipes and hoses checked for leaks.
  2. All clamps tightened
  3. IC cleaned.
  4. ECU battery pull for 20mins.
  5. VGT valve physically felt for the actuator shaft movement and what rpm its happening.
  6. timing belt tension checked.
  7. Clutch slippage checked - changed at 50k later.
  8. air filter and complete hoses cleaned.
I still experience the power blip around 1800-2200rpm. Its become pronounced now. Since my car has only 45k on the odo, the only possible fault i can imagine is the turbo. I never religiously followed the 1min idle principle and expect this to have had an effect on bearings................ but why only between 1800-2000???.



btw, you didnt mention if your problem happens at 3500rpm in all gears or only at 170mph in OD.

You can check for 0-100 times of your car,it would give u clear indication what sort of power your motor is making.if there is any issue with turbo,boost leak etc,it would simply fail to get close to stock times.
Launch in 2nd and shift every time around 3700.
Its easy to get 11.5 secs.i guess if you get within 12,motor is pretty much good.
If you find your times tobe within range,and power loss is only with 4th and 5th,you can disconnect the sensor on the gearbox (gearselector box).without that sensor,ecu is devoid of in gear data,and engine is pretty much at peak tune in all gears.
Test your car if it can cros 170 then.
Do not discnt with engine running/ign on. And you would get much less FE without that sensor.
Also you really do not need to worry about idlin for a min before shut down,hardly matters with such easy duty turbos
